Home Insurance Covers Your Boat

One of the myths related to boat insurance is that it isn’t needed because home insurance covers a boat stored on your property. Some home insurance policies will cover a boat stored in your garage or backyard, but most are starting to exclude toys stored at your home, including boats and four wheelers. As such, it is important to have a separate boat insurance policy to cover your boat. 

Boat Insurance Covers You Wherever You Go Boating

Another common myth is that boat insurance covers you regardless of where you boat. This is not true. Some policies limit what types of bodies of water you can have your boat in, what states you can have your boat in or where you can travel in your boat. Always review your policy to ensure your boat is covered wherever you plan on using it.
